Radha Devi is a mother of two and a woman with an extraordinary heart. For over ten years, she has devoted herself to the care and protection of the animals who are often overlooked and forgotten — wildlife and feral cats alike.

Rain or shine, hot or cold, Radha can be found twice a day tending to them — making sure they are fed, warm, safe, and loved.

When she saw dozens of sick and suffering feral cats in her community, she couldn’t turn away. She used her own money to have them spayed and neutered, treated their illnesses, and slowly created a safe haven for them inside an old barn.

She brought electricity, built heated sleeping beds, created protected areas, and filled the space with toys and comfort. Over time, more than 40 cats came to trust her — running to her when she arrived with food, recognizing her voice, knowing she was their protector.

This work has never been about recognition or reward. It has always been about compassion.

Now, the barn that has sheltered them is no longer available. Without a new home, these cats face winter without protection.
